Day 1: ARRIVE IN SAN FRANCISCO
Welcome to San Francisco! At 6 pm, meet your Tour Director and traveling companions for a welcome drink.

Day 2: SAN FRANCISCO
City by the Bay Enjoy morning sightseeing in one of the world’s most beautiful cities. See Golden Gate National Recreation Area, including the Golden Gate Bridge and the Presidio. Free time this afternoon to explore the city. Ride the world-famous cable cars, shop in Union Square, or visit the Museum of Modern Art. Dinner at a local restaurant this evening. (Breakfast,Dinner)
LOCAL FAVORITECULTURE & TRADITION As the song goes, you’ll leave your heart in San Francisco with a stroll through the exquisite Japanese Tea Garden. Walk the beautiful landscapes in the oldest public Japanese garden in the United States. Learn about the history of the park and enjoy time to explore the five acres of native Japanese plants, serene koi ponds, pagodas, and more.

Day 3: SAN FRANCISCO–EXCURSION TO SAUSALITO & SONOMA
Vineyards & Views Travel across the Golden Gate Bridge this morning to the charming town of Sausalito. Continue to Sonoma for lunch on your own. Visit a local vineyard for a tour and tasting. (Breakfast)
TOUR HIGHLIGHTTASTES & TRADITIONS Cross San Francisco Bay on the iconic Golden Gate Bridge to stroll the quaint artisan avenues of Sausalito. Enjoy waterfront views and breathtaking scenery in the charming waterfront village with a large variety of shops, restaurants, and art galleries. Venture to Sonoma with its wealth of verdant vineyards for a wine tasting.

Day 4: SAN FRANCISCO–YOSEMITE NATIONAL PARK
The Mountains are Calling Travel eastward through the Sierra Nevada Mountains to Yosemite National Park. Free time this evening. (Breakfast)
TOUR HIGHLIGHT NATURAL WONDERS Yosemite has innumerable lakes, meadows, ice-sculpted domes, forests, waterfalls, and unspoiled alpine scenery. Descend into the 4,000-foot valley for an open-air Valley Floor Tram to explore the famous sites of El Capitan, Cathedral Spires, Yosemite Falls, and Half Dome. Here, John Muir realized, “The mountains are calling, and I must go.” We think you’ll agree.

Day 5: YOSEMITE NATIONAL PARK–MONTEREY
Giants of the Land and Sea Before departing Yosemite National Park, visit Mariposa Grove, home to many old-growth sequoias. Stand in awe as you look skyward at these massive giants, one of the Earth’s largest and longest living organisms. Then, on to Monterey, home to the famed Cannery Row. (Breakfast)
TOUR HIGHLIGHT HISTORY & HERITAGE Immortalized by John Steinbeck in his novel of the same name, Cannery Row is filled with history and vibrant sights along the waterfront of Monterey Bay. Once a bustling district of sardine factories, the street is a brightly painted avenue of eateries and shops that harken back to a heritage of fishermen and rich stories. In the morning, stroll along the wharf for the chance to see whales, otters, and other sea creatures in the kelp forests of the Pacific Ocean shore.

Day 7: MONTEREY–BIG SUR–SAN SIMEON–SOLVANG
California Gold Journey south through Big Sur to San Simeon and visit Hearst Castle. Continue to Solvang for a free evening. (Breakfast)
TOUR HIGHLIGHT LEGENDARY LIVES Visit the opulent mansion of legendary newspaper tycoon William Randolph Hearst, which houses splendid antiques, art treasures, and exotic possessions purchased at an estimated $50 million. Your guided tour shows off the highlights of the impressive 123-acre estate.

Day 8: SOLVANG–SANTA BARBARA–LOS ANGELES
Treasures & Traditions Explore the Danish town of Solvang and enjoy a [LF] Danish specialty at a local bakery. Then, travel through the Santa Ynez Mountains to beautiful Santa Barbara to visit the Old Mission Santa Barbara. Continue to metropolitan Los Angeles, the motion picture capital of the world. (Breakfast)
LOCAL FAVORITECULTURAL GEM Stroll the streets of Solvang and feel as though you’ve entered a charming Danish town with picturesque buildings and shops, restaurants and windmills that create a taste of Denmark in California’s Santa Ynez Valley. Enjoy a traditional Danish pastry at Mortensen’s famous bakery.
TOUR HIGLIGHTHISTORY & HERITAGE Experience the beauty and history of California’s mission trail with a visit to Old Mission Santa Barbara. Soak in the stunning Spanish influence of the 1786 “Queen of the Missions” with its wrought iron, terra cotta, and carved wood. Feel the serenity amid its whitewashed walls and tile-roofed buildings below its chiming twin bell towers ringing out on the Camino Real above the beautiful Pacific Ocean.

DAY 3: LAS VEGAS > DEATH VALLEY > MAMMOTH LAKES/FRESNO
Having enjoyed glamorous Las Vegas, it will be a sharp contrast this afternoon to enter the quiet and extreme environment of Death Valley. Stop at Zabriskie Point and Furnace Creek Ranch/Visitors Center before continuing across the valley and ascending the Sierra Nevada Mountains to the alpine resort town of Mammoth Lakes. The area gained prominence as a gold mining town in the 19th century and today is renowned for its superior skiing terrain and staggeringly beautiful mountain vistas.
Important note: Winter Routing The Tioga Pass may be closed due to weather or road conditions, in which case you will overnight in Fresno or Visalia and a visit to Mammoth Lakes will not be possible (winter routing applies to all departures between October and May under normal snow conditions).
